Importing —dealing with controlled drugs — class A — methamphetamine — Misuse of Drugs Act 1975, s 6(1)(a). The defendant appeared for sentencing on one charge of importing methamphetamine, a class A controlled drug. The charge carries a sentence of up to life imprisonment under the Act. The defendant was sentenced to 10 years imprisonment with a minimum parole period of 5 years. The defendant and three associates had travelled from Taiwan to New Zealand where, at Auckland International Airport, customs officers found 9.11 kilograms of methamphetamine concealed in suitcases.
